BACON AND PARMESAN PENNE PASTA RECIPE | ALLRECIPES



Bacon and Parmesan Penne Pasta Recipe | Allrecipes image

This pasta recipe is so easy to make and so flavorful, you will want to make it part of your regular dinner routine. It is a great option for bacon lovers, and those who want something other than red sauce on their pasta.

Provided by SusieQ

Categories     Side Dishes

Total Time 30 minutes

Prep Time 10 minutes

Cook Time 20 minutes

Yield 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 5

1 pound bacon, coarsely chopped
1 onion, chopped
1 pound dry penne pasta
¼ cup olive oil
½ cup grated Parmesan cheese

Steps:

  • Place the chopped bacon and onion in a skillet over medium heat, and cook and stir until the bacon is crisp and the onion is beginning to brown, about 10 minutes.
  • While the bacon and onion are cooking, fill a large pot with lightly salted water and bring to a rolling boil over high heat. Once the water is boiling, stir in the penne, and return to a boil. Cook the pasta uncovered, stirring occasionally, until cooked through, but is still firm to the bite, about 11 minutes. Drain pasta, transfer to a large serving bowl, and stir in the olive oil to coat the pasta.
  • Drain the bacon grease from the skillet, leaving a couple of tablespoons or to taste. Stir the cooked bacon mixture into the pasta, and sprinkle the Parmesan cheese over the pasta. Stir to mix in the cheese, and serve.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 411.6 calories, CarbohydrateContent 45.5 g, CholesterolContent 24.9 mg, FatContent 17.3 g, FiberContent 2.8 g, ProteinContent 17.2 g, SaturatedFatContent 4.6 g, SodiumContent 508.8 mg, SugarContent 1.4 g

CHICKEN PENNE ITALIANO RECIPE | ALLRECIPES



Chicken Penne Italiano Recipe | Allrecipes image

An Italian version of stir-fry, this tasty dish mixes cubed, boneless chicken and penne pasta with red and green peppers, garlic, tomatoes, oregano, and basil for an easy weeknight supper.

Provided by Jeanine Farrar Bubick

Categories     Italian Recipes

Total Time 55 minutes

Prep Time 25 minutes

Cook Time 30 minutes

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 14

8 ounces dry penne pasta
1 tablespoon cornstarch
1 (15 ounce) can chicken broth
2 tablespoons olive oil
1 tablespoon garlic, minced
4 skinless, boneless chicken breast halves - cut into cubes
1 onion, sliced
½ green bell pepper, seeded and thinly sliced
½ red bell pepper, seeded and thinly sliced
1 (16 ounce) can diced tomatoes
1 teaspoon dried oregano
1 teaspoon dried basil
¼ cup medium-dry white wine
½ c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ese

Steps:

  • Bring a large pot of lightly salted water to a boil. Add the penne pasta and cook until al dente, 8 to 10 minutes. Drain, and reserve pasta.
  • Whisk the cornstarch and chicken broth together in a bowl until smooth. Set aside until needed.
  • Heat the ol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add the garlic and chicken; stir and cook until the chicken is no longer pink and juices run clear, about 10 minutes. Stir in the onion, and green and red peppers; cook until tender, about 5 minutes. Stir in the tomatoes, and simmer for 10 minutes. Pour in the chicken broth mixture and wine, if desired, and season with oregano and basil. Stir in the cooked pasta, and simmer over medium heat until thoroughly heated through, about 5 minutes. Serve garnished with Parmesan cheese.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 527.4 calories, CarbohydrateContent 56.4 g, CholesterolContent 80.9 mg, FatContent 15 g, FiberContent 4.8 g, ProteinContent 39.3 g, SaturatedFatContent 4.2 g, SodiumContent 926.7 mg, SugarContent 8.7 g

PREGNANT JOOLS' PASTA | PASTA RECIPES | JAMIE OLIVER RECIPES
A simply tasty pasta combining sausage, chilli and fennel – everything Jools was craving when she was pregnant with Buddy – a firm favourite in the Oliver household. 
From jamieoliver.com
Total Time 30 minutes
Calories 502 calories per serving
    1. Trim the spring onions, carrot and celery. Roughly chop all the vegetables, then blitz in the food processor with the chillies (stalks removed). Add the sausages, 1 heaped teaspoon of fennel seeds and 1 teaspoon of oregano. Keep pulsing until well mixed, then spoon this mixture into a large frying pan on a high heat with a lug of olive oil, breaking it up and stirring as you go. Keep checking on it and stirring while you get on with other jobs.
    2. Fill a large deep saucepan with boiling water. Season well then add the penne and cook according to packet instructions, with the lid askew.
    3. Crush 4 unpeeled cloves of garlic into the sausage mixture and stir in 4 tablespoons of balsamic vinegar and the tinned tomatoes. Add a little of the starchy cooking water from the pasta to loosen if needed.
    4. Drain the pasta, reserving about a wineglass worth of the cooking water. Tip the pasta into the pan of sauce and give it a gentle stir, adding enough of the cooking water to bring it to a silky consistency. Taste, correct the seasoning, then tip into a large serving bowl and take straight to the table with the Parmesan for grating over. Scatter over a few basil leaves.
